Tamzin Outhwaite: ‘Next year or never’ EastEnders star drops major Strictly 2019 spoiler


Tamzin Outhwaite, 48, has revealed that her daughters are “desperate” for the EastEnders actress to take part in the dance competition. The soap star spoke candidly about being part of the show but added she does feel she is a “bit old” for Strictly. Speaking in an interview with OK! Magazine, Tamzin spilled: “My girls are desperate for me to do it but I think I’m a bit old, I’m not sure my body could take it. “I’m 49 soon, so part of me thinks I should do it next year as a last hurrah before my fifties.”

She added: “It’s next year or never.”

The actress shares daughters Florence, 11, and seven-year-old Marnie with her ex-husband Tom Ellis.

Meanwhile, Tamzin has since found love with 28-year-old boyfriend and documentary maker Tom Child.

Speaking about the couple’s age gap, the Eastenders star admitted people used to make jokes about it but has insisted it’s never bothered them.

She said: “The age gap bothers other people but not us!

“I did initially question whether a 20-year age difference would work but we couldn’t stay away from each other.

“At first we heard lots of jokes about our ages but now people see how happy we are, all that has stopped.

“Also I’m very much the kid in our relationship.”

Tamzin first met Tom in 2016 before making their romance official in 2017.

The pair took their relationship to the next level recently when he moved into her family home.

Tamzin went on to praise Tom for “fitting in perfectly” with her family.

She continued: “He knows the girls are the loves of my life and he’d never try to compete with that.

“It’s obviously a big deal to introduce a new partner into your children’s lives but Tom’s fitted in perfectly.”

The actress also said she would be open to tying the knot with Tom, despite her last marriage not ending “perfectly”.

Elsewhere, Tamzin revealed she is leaving the soap after 21 on-off years in the show.

In view of her 213,000 Twitter followers she said: “So that’s it! The end of an era… for me at least.

“Melanie Healy/Beale/Owen has left the building… it’s been a pleasure, a privilege and a 21 year association with a family I will cherish forever and never forget.”

She added: “TIL next time my beautiful cast and crew… you all rock.”(sic)
